Fire truck in rollover crash en route to fire

The Ford F550 brush truck left the road and struck a bolder; both firefighters inside were treated on scene for minor injuries

DOUGLAS COUNTY, Wash. — A fire truck was involved in a rollover accident while responding to a brush fire in rural Douglas County on Friday evening.

Douglas County Sheriff Harvey Gjesdal said the brush truck, a Ford F550, went off the road, struck a boulder and then rolled completely over. Two firefighters inside suffered minor injuries and were treated at the scene.

The accident happened just outside of Bridgeport, and the truck was from Douglas County Fire District 3 out of the Grand Coulee area.

Numerous fire agencies from Chelan and Douglas counties responded after a fire near the top of McNeil Canyon Road quickly went to a second alarm.

The fire was started from a combine harvesting wheat near the intersection of Road 13 NW and Highway 172, said Tyler Caille, chief of Douglas County Fire District 5.

Driven by wind, the blaze grew to 100 acres -- and came within a half mile of one home -- before it was contained around 7:30 p.m.

Responding agencies including Douglas County fire districts 1, 3, 4, 5, Chelan County fire districts 5 and 7, and Douglas-Okanogan Fire District 15. Douglas County Fire District 2 in East Wenatchee nd Chelan County Fire District 1 in Wenatchee had trucks enroute to the fire but were turned back.
